Two superbly talented producers whose releases are few and far between. But as ever, Solead knock our socks off with this EP.
It might be best served cold, but the synths in Ice Cream are as warm as they get - saurated with sweetness. Throw in perfectly pitched kicks, energetic percussion and a P-Funk bassline in there and it's time for whiskey and cigars on the dancefloor.
Les Capitales brings freeform jazz to carnival funk. Razor sharp claps and a street party bassline give the tune a rolling groove around which perfectly orchestrated noise glides likes a dangerous snake.
The street party continues with Mola Mola. Timbales roll, claps snap and kick drums pound. Trumpets punch the air and, occasionally, the sound of the jungle around you cuts through the mix. A tune for a hot summer night.
Moonlight is just as you'd expect it to be - ethereal and moody. Percussion elements combine to build a surging rhythm for acid-sharp synths and creepy vocals to hang on to.
Oasis treads a more minimalist path until water is found and the celebrations start. Jubilant chanting flows over the rock-solid groove that just grows and grows.
Every track here is a masterclass in engineering. Solead pull some percussion tricks that many more prolific producers would sell their grandmothers for. Turn it up and enjoy!
